Yemi Alade also "Slams" BET over "Backstage" Awards

Just yesterday, Ghanaian born UK based musician FUSE ODG slam the organisers of the BET Awards for what he calls disrespectfulness to their (musicians) hardwork and achievements due to the fact that, International Acts category of the awards is received backstage and not on the main stage.
 
As if that is not enough, Nigerian female artiste, Yemi Alade has also thrown the same stone to BET Organisers.
 
The "Johnny" hitmaker lashed out her anger on the organisers via her IG Handle though she was a nominee for the Best International Act Africa category which was won by Ghanaian Dancehall artiste Stonebwoy.
 
Winners of the International Act categoryies are awarded hours before the main event and this doesnot taste good for the artistes who are nominated.
Yemi sees this as humiliation on the African artistes and concluded that "If African artists are not worthy in your sight, please by all means Cancel, Delete, Ommit the Best International Act (Africa) Category out of the glorified Award".
 
Read her message:

"By the way…@bet_intl AFRICA IS NOT A COUNTRY.!!! ..IT IS WRONG TO NOMINATE HUGE AFRICAN STARS AND PUBLICLY TRY TO HUMILIATE AFRICA.WHY ON EARTH IS THE AFRICAN CATEGORY OF THE AWARDS HELD HOURS BEFORE THE “MAIN EVENT? IF AFRICAN ARTISTS ARE NOT WORTHY IN YOUR SIGHT.”

“PLS BY ALL MEANS CANCEL,DELETE,OMMIT THE “BEST INTERNATIONAL ACT (AFRICA) CATEGORY OUT OF THIS GLORIFIED AWARD. THIS IS WRONG! !! WRONG WRONG WRONG WRONG.”

“Mainwhile… PLS NEXT TIME,CREDIBILITY OVER PADDYPADDY!! CREDIBILITY !!”
